Canon SX410 IS vs Nikon S9900 Physical Comparison

For anybody who is aiming to carry your camera regularly, you have to take into account its weight and proportions. The Canon SX410 IS comes with outer measurements of 104mm x 69mm x 85mm (4.1" x 2.7" x 3.3") along with a weight of 325 grams (0.72 lbs) while the Nikon S9900 has measurements of 112mm x 66mm x 40mm (4.4" x 2.6" x 1.6") with a weight of 289 grams (0.64 lbs).

Canon SX410 IS vs Nikon S9900 Sensor Comparison

Sometimes, its difficult to envision the difference between sensor sizing merely by looking at specifications. The visual here will help offer you a far better sense of the sensor measurements in the SX410 IS and S9900.

Plainly, the 2 cameras have the same sensor dimensions but not the same megapixels. You can expect to see the Canon SX410 IS to give more detail because of its extra 4MP. Greater resolution will also let you crop pics a bit more aggressively.
